Daily Current Affairs / Retired IAS Officer S. Radha Chauhan Takes Charge as Capacity Building Commission Chairperson:
Category : Appointment/Resignation Published on: August 09 2025
Mrs. S. Radha Chauhan, a retired IAS officer from the 1988 Uttar Pradesh cadre, officially took over as the Chairperson of the Capacity Building Commission in New Delhi. She succeeds Shri Adil Zainulbhai, who served in the role since April 2021. Known for her administrative experience across both State and Central Governments, Chauhan previously served as Secretary in the Department of Personnel and Training (DoPT) and brings extensive knowledge in public administration and institutional capacity development.
